Jury convenes in Maastricht this week!
This week the international jury will convene in Maastricht to go through all the 380 submissions and nominate 5 designs/ designers within each category and furthermore appoint the 5 winners. The Great Indoors is very honoured and pleased to announce the members of our international jury:

Jo Coenen, architect (NL)
Dirk van den Heuvel, theorist (NL)
Anne Højgaard Jørgensen, head of design Kvadrat (DK)
Anniina Koivu, design editor Abitare magazine (IT)
Joep van Lieshout, artist (NL)
Giulio Ridolfo, colour consultant (IT)

Hurray! Record number of entries!
Maybe it is the growing reputation of the award or possibly it is connected to the crises and the urgency of communication, but The Great Indoors was honoured to receive a total amount of 380 entries in five different categories. 50% More registrations than the previous edition!
For us this is an illustration of the need for our Award within the field and beyond, to recognise and celebrate best examples of non-private interior design.
Entries were submitted by all the big names in the field but we were also excited to receive entries from (still) unknown talents.
At the end of October, the jury will compose a shortlist of twenty-five designs.
